Staff Judge Advocate to JTF-170. Signed an attachment to the Dunlavey Memo of Oct 11 2002, called the Beaver Legal Brief. . It's title was Legal Review of Aggressive Interrogation Techniques.
* Was a military police officer
* Was a lawyer for the Pentagon
* Lead 'brainstorming' at Guantanamo about interrogations, with CIA, DIA, and others, about 30 people in all sometimes, all men.
* Claimed the tv show 24 was watched by guantanamo staff and 'gave people lots of ideas'.
* visited Abu Grahib in Aug 2003 with General Miller
